Purpose of the role: You will be the one to take full accountability in driving consistent improvement to the stores sales, KPI’s and all other areas of measured success. You will recruit, retain, motivate and develop the team to drive the success of the store, whilst maintaining exceptional visual merchandising standards throughout the store and create a shopping experience that delights our customers every time.
Responsibilities:
- Delivering LFL growth of both sales and KPI performance in the store
- Maintaining impeccable visual merchandising standards throughout the store ensuring effective use of space and stock availability
- Complying with reasonable instructions from senior members of the retail team
- Developing, reviewing and appraising your team based on key performance indicators and performance managing poor performers
- Ensuring integrity of the brand is maintained through correct behaviours and uniform standards of the team
- Controlling payroll and other store expenditures ensuring they come within budget
- Training and inducting your team to deliver excellent customer service
Key Skills and Experience:
- Essential: Customer service focused, Sales and target driven, Excellent visual merchandising skills, Commercial awareness, Good communication skills
- Desirable: Good IT skills, Experience of managing poor performance, Experience of working in a premium fashion brand

How to prepare for a job interview at Crew Clothing Westfield
✨Know Your Numbers
Before the interview, brush up on your sales and KPI knowledge. Be ready to discuss how you've driven growth in previous roles. This shows you understand the importance of metrics in retail and can bring that expertise to Crew Clothing.
✨Visual Merchandising Mastery
Familiarise yourself with the latest trends in visual merchandising. Bring examples of how you've created engaging displays in past positions. This will demonstrate your ability to maintain impeccable standards and enhance the shopping experience.
✨Team Development Focus
Prepare to talk about your experience in recruiting, training, and motivating teams. Share specific examples of how you've managed performance and developed talent. This will highlight your leadership skills and commitment to team success.
✨Customer-Centric Mindset
Think of instances where you've gone above and beyond for customers. Be ready to discuss how you ensure exceptional customer service. This aligns perfectly with Crew Clothing's values and shows you're a great fit for their culture.
